Limited Correspondent. For a period of sixty (60) calendar days after the Closing Date, Seller will act as Buyer’s limited correspondent for the processing of checks, drafts and withdrawal orders drawn before or after the Closing on the draft, check or withdrawal order forms provided by Seller on Deposits assumed by Buyer hereunder. For the 60-day period, Seller will use commercially reasonable efforts to transmit to Buyer via facsimile or by imaging, on a timely basis, a copy of each day’s checks, drafts and withdrawal orders, which are on draft, check or withdrawal order forms provided by Seller on Deposits assumed by Buyer hereunder. Buyer will determine disposition of presented items and notify Seller of such disposition within three (3) hours of receipt of the copies of such items, if receipt occurs on a business day between the hours of 8:00 a.m. and 3:00 p.m., or by 10:00 a.m. the following business day if receipt does not occur on a business day between the hours of 8:00 a.m. and 3:00 p.m. Items mistakenly routed or presented after the 60-day period will be returned. Seller and Buyer will make arrangements to provide for the daily settlement through the Clearing Account (as defined below) with immediately available funds by Buyer of any such items honored by Seller pursuant to Buyer’s instructions.

Limited Correspondent. Prior to the Closing Date, Seller and Buyer will develop the appropriate procedures and arrangements (which shall include establishment by Buyer of the settlement account with Seller per Section 9.05 below) to provide for settlement by Buyer of checks, drafts, withdrawal orders, returns and other items that are drawn on or chargeable against Deposits after the Closing Date. Seller will cooperate with Buyer and take reasonable steps requested by Buyer to ensure that, for a period of sixty (60) days after the Closing Date, each check, draft or withdrawal order drawn against Deposits encoded for presentment to Seller or to any bank for the account of Seller is delivered to Buyer in a timely manner and in accordance with applicable law and clearinghouse rule or agreement. Consistent therewith, for a period of sixty (60) calendar days after the Closing Date, Seller shall act as Buyer’s limited correspondent for the processing of checks, drafts and withdrawal orders drawn before or after the Closing on the draft, check or withdrawal order forms provided by Seller on Deposits assumed by Buyer hereunder, and Buyer will honor and pay all such checks, drafts and withdrawal orders if duly endorsed and to the extent that the credit balances or overdraft privileges of the drawers or makers permit; provided, that Seller shall present all such checks, drafts and withdrawal orders to the Buyer’s designated courier at or before 5:00 p.m. on the date such checks, drafts or withdrawals are received by Seller.
